Having trouble figuring out Blender 3D on your own? These Blender 3D Tutorial Videos will get you off to a great start.  I am pleased to offer these free Blender tutorials available to help you learn Blender and 3d animation quickly.

Blender is a powerful  and capable free 3D software package  for commercial or personal use.

I have worked with Blender for the past 12 years creating 3D animation for television pilots, commercial presentations, corporate graphic and visualizations.  In  addition to using Blender on a daily basis in my work, I teach Blender to college graphic arts students. These videos are suitable for anyone with basic computer skills wanting to learn Blender. Whether you are 8 or 80 I hope these will help you quickly develop a strong foundation in Blender 3D.

Learning Blender will take patience and practice but it is worth the effort.

When I first began learning Blender, it made my head hurt. There was so much to learn and I did not not know where to begin.   I quickly discovered that learning to use 3D animation software has much in common with learning a musical instrument. Just like learning to play the guitar or piano, you and your fingers will develop a memory for the the keyboard and mouse movements that will allow you to create with proficiency. It will take some patience and some practice, but the reward will be the ability to create amazing objects, images, animations and games with competence and confidence.  So when your head starts to hurt take a break and then come back to it again. You will find its gets easier as you go.
